Extreme Plastic Repair by Lord Fusor is a 1.7 oz high-strength, fast-setting adhesive designed for bonding and refinishing a wide range of automotive plastics including TPO, TEO, PP, SMC, ABS, and FRP. Its black color and featheredge finish deliver seamless, durable repairs for bumpers, trims, and interior parts, with water resistance and compatibility enhanced by Fusor surface modifiers.

E**R
Saved me $4,850.00
Front bumper of BMW got ripped off by a parking spot curb divider that caught bottom of bumper. Body shop quotes were $4,900.00 -> $6,000.00 to replace paint etc. The mounting tabs tore. I order this epoxy and squeezed in the mounting areas and held the bumper in place for 20 mins with my hands and it stuck. Can’t even tell something happened. Been driving on interstates and no issues. Cures shiny black The gun works great

T**R
Anyone who tells you epoxy or super glue will fix it is lying or a moron
I discovered this product when the owner of the shop where I had my truck restored (Byer's Customs and Restoration, Auburn, Washington) used it when they broke some ABS clip mount points on some interior panels for my truck interior. ABS is almost impossible to repair. Anyone who tells you epoxy or super glue will fix it is lying or a moron. Nothing chemically bonds, on a molecular level, with ABS except a product sold by a gentleman in Nevada, and products like Lord Fusor 143 and 153 (3M also makes a product line for these repairs). The product is manufactured for the auto body profession, to repair bumper covers and other odd plastic composition parts on a car. Let me tell you, this stuff bonds absolutely strong, does not come off under ANY stress, and is stronger than the plastic it repairs. And you can sand it. I recommend (as does Lord Co.) using Lord's surface modifier, Fusor 602 for better adhesion. Apply prior to using Fusor 143, follow their instructions.
